Acronis True Image 2009 - E000101F4 - Can't Find Any Hard Disk Drives

Thread needs solution

I have been unable to successfully restore a new computer that was just purchased using Acronis True Image 2009. If I try to boot from the CD, I get E00101F4 (can't find any hard disk drives). If I run it from Windows, I get an error when it reboots. The computer is a Jetway NF9J-Q87 motherboard with Intel i7 4770S 3.1 GHz processor and 4GB 1333 MHz DDR3 SODIMM. Any insight as to why I can't load this system is appreciated.

ATIH 2009 is very old. The drivers included with that version, even the latest build probably doesn't support the Q87 based storage controller or other if equipped. Upgrading to a later version of Acronis should help. Keep in mind that the software you are using needs to support both the OS and hardware you are running it on.
